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3973198 6152817 6501712 23851693187
495 907998865
495 907998865
27903435174 305 930267 058643652
All about undefined
Interested in learning more?
495 907998865
27903435174 305 930267 058643652
See more
3776830243 67163539709 496
418 620172012 9167
See more
253494 475212 13
00157144 7202 66
See more